What is Zoomcar Holdings Equity-to-Asset?

Equity to Asset ratio is calculated as total stockholders equity divided by total asset. Zoomcar Holdings's Total Stockholders Equity for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$-26.23 Mil. Zoomcar Holdings's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$16.85 Mil. Therefore, Zoomcar Holdings's Equity to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-1.56.

Zoomcar Holdings Equity-to-Asset Calculation

Equity to Asset ratio measures the ratios of the portion of the asset owned by shareholders out of the total asset. It indicates the leverage of the company, and the amount of debt the company uses in its operation.

Equity to Asset ratio is calculated by dividing total stockholders equity by total asset.

Zoomcar Holdings's Equity to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2023 is calculated as

Equity to Asset (A: Mar. 2023 )=Total Stockholders Equity/Total Assets
=-246.032/16.458
=-14.95

Zoomcar Holdings's Equity to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Equity to Asset (Q: Dec. 2023 )=Total Stockholders Equity/Total Assets
=-26.231/16.847
=-1.56

Zoomcar Holdings  (NAS:ZCAR) Equity-to-Asset Explanation

Equity to Asset ratio can vary greatly across different industries, as they have different capital structure. A company with smaller Equity to Asset ratio (more leveraged) may have higher ROE % because of the leverage.

For banks, the required minimum Equity to Asset ratio by regulation is 5%. Some stronger banks may have Equity to Asset Ratio of more than 10%.

Zoomcar Holdings Inc is India's largest marketplace for cars on rent. Zoomcar is a leading emerging-market-focused peer-to-peer car-sharing marketplace, with approximately 21,000 vehicles registered through its platform. The Company derives its revenue principally from short-term self-drive rentals and vehicle subscriptions. The self-drive rental business generates the majority of revenue. Geographically The company operates in India, Egypt, Indonesia, Vietnam, and the Philippines, Out of which the majority of revenue is derived from India.
